Went to an Orvis store.  Their main business is outdoor stuff, but they also have a decent selection of watches:

orvis_watch

It is a 30 minute mechanical chronograph, handwind.  It worked well and is a nice size, looks like 40mm or so across.  The band is not my favorite, but that can be easily changed.  Looks like 20mm lugs.  Their collection of quartz watches was nice as well, and the quality seems pretty comparable to good fashion watches like Fossil.

Finally, saw some Native American designed bands, pretty neat styles, but they just weren’t me:

navajo


navajo_1

These are Navajo and Zuni bands, respectively.  Navajo use whole stones and set around them, the Zuni shape and set their stones in intricate patterns.  Both are sterling silver.  I did get a ring, Zuni made.
